Sour cream n chive potato bread

Yield: 1 Servings

Measure Ingredient
\N \N -- One pound loaf:; 1 1/2 pound:
\N \N Potato mixture:
½ cup Water; 3/4 cup
⅓ cup Potatoes; 1/2 cup peeled and chopped
¼ cup Sour cream; 1/3 cup or lowfat yogurt
\N \N Dough:
1 tablespoon Butter or margarine; 1 Tab.
¾ teaspoon Salt; 1 tsp.
2¼ cup Bread flour; 3 1/2 cups
1 tablespoon Spice Island snipped chives; 4 tsp
2 teaspoons Sugar; 1 Tab.
1¼ teaspoon Active dry yeast; 1 1/2 tsp. Bread machine yeast
\N 1 cup (1 1/3 cup.)

Potato mixture: In a small saucepan combine water and potato. Bring to boiling; reduce heat. Cook, covered, 8 to 9 minutes or until potato is very tender. Do not drain; cool. Mash potato in the water. Measure potato mixture. Add cour cream and enough milk to make 1 cup (1⅓ cups for 1 ½ loaf.)

Dough: Add potato mixture and dough ingredients to bread machine pan in the order suggested by manufacturer, treating potato mixture as a liquid.

Recommended cycle: Basic/ white bread cycle; medium/ normal color setting To save time: Use instant potato flakes instead of fresh potato. Use ¼ cup for 1 pound loaf (⅓ cup for 1 ½ pound loaf).
